Coforge Ltd
| Q2 FY2026 Earnings Conference Call
Summary : Coforge delivered exceptional Q2 FY26 results, driven by strong AI-led growth, robust order intake, and healthy margins, with a positive outlook despite macro uncertainties.

Business Overview
- Coforge reported an exceptional Q2 FY26 with 5.9% sequential constant currency growth.
- EBIT for the quarter was 14%, reflecting robust business health and margin progression.
- The 12-month signed order book reached a record $1.63 billion, up 26.7% year-on-year.
- AI is deeply embedded in delivery models, transforming core business and BPO services.
- Employee attrition fell to 11.4%, one of the lowest in the industry.

Risk Factors
- Uncertain macros continue to swirl around the industry.
- Hedge losses impacted reported revenue and EBIT.
- DSO has increased due to significant year-on-year growth and currency movements.
- Wage hikes will impact Q3 margins, though levers exist to partially offset.
Good To Know
- NCLT approval for Cigniti merger expected by December/January, effective April 1, 2025.
- Healthcare vertical may be carved out for separate reporting in Q1 FY27 once it reaches $100 million.
- John Speight has been added to the Board, while Gautam has resigned.
- The company aims to maintain free cash flow to PAT ratio at 70-80% going forward.
- ETR on a sustained basis is expected to be roughly 23.5% to 24%.

Financial Highlights
- Management aims for sustained robust growth, minimum 14% EBIT, and 70-80% FCF to PAT.
- The gap between CC and dollar revenue growth is attributed to hedge losses, currency headwinds, and India business growth.
- DSO increase is due to 30% YoY growth and currency impact, with focus on maintaining FCF to PAT.
- Wage hikes will cause a 100-150 bps margin drop in Q3, partially offset by ESOP and depreciation.
- Discounting income on long-term contracts is recognized as 90% revenue upfront, 10% as other income.
Product Composition
- Healthcare growth is driven by AI for patient care, end-to-end platforms, and focus on payer/life science.
- Cigniti acquisition has led to strong cross-selling, with large deals already signed from its client portfolio.
- AI-led platforms are driving an upward trend in revenue per employee, though it's still early days.
